    On 14 Nov 2020, at 00:47, Ravi Pokala <rpokala@freebsd.org> wrote:
    > 
    >>   +#define FIRMWARE_RELEASE_DATE	"11/10/2020"
    > 
    > Might I suggest "2020-11-10", as sorting, logic, ${DEITY}, and ISO-8601 demand? ;-)

    Alas that is a "feature" of the specification:

      String number of the BIOS release date. The date string, if supplied,
      is in either mm/dd/yy or mm/dd/yyyy format. If the year portion of the
      string is two digits, the year is assumed to be 19yy.

      NOTE: The mm/dd/yyyy format is required for SMBIOS version 2.3 and
      later.

    (SMBIOS Specification version 3.4.0c)
